"in some cases I'd rather a stuck engine too since sometimes it means the toleraces are still tight." I don't think thats true. I mean, in one way it is true, the tolerances are too tight which is why its stuck. The problem is when it frees up its quite likely to have (or develop) a broken ring. Its also real easy to break other stuff if you hurry while freeing up a stuck engine. This isn't to say a stuck tractor engine is the end of the road but I don't think I'd ever prefer one...
